The Executive Chairman of Isoko North Local Government Area of Delta State, Hon. (Elder) Prince Godwin Ogorugba, has pledged his administration’s continued support for initiatives aimed at promoting legal awareness, justice, peace and order across the council area.

Ogorugba gave the assurance on Thursday when the newly elected executive members of the Nigerian Bar Association (NBA), Oleh Branch, led by Mr. Timothy Agbaragu, Esq., paid him a courtesy visit at his office in Ozoro.

Welcoming the delegation, the council chairman congratulated the new NBA executives on their successful election and commended them for visiting the local government leadership.

He stressed the importance of legal education and public enlightenment in building a peaceful and law-abiding society, noting that many disputes, crimes, fraud and exploitation could be prevented if citizens understood their rights, responsibilities and the consequences of violating the law.

According to Ogorugba, ignorance of the law often leaves citizens vulnerable to avoidable victimisation and exploitation.

“If you are not enlightened, you will be defrauded,” the chairman said, calling for stronger collaboration between the council and the NBA to take legal awareness programmes to communities across Isoko North.

He said his administration was ready to partner with the NBA in public legal education, advocacy and community sensitisation, stressing that lawyers had a vital role to play in strengthening citizens’ understanding of the law and promoting peaceful resolution of disputes.

Ogorugba also reaffirmed his commitment to the rule of law, justice and responsible governance, noting that sustainable development could only flourish in an atmosphere of peace, order and respect for the law.

He urged professional bodies, traditional and community leaders, as well as other stakeholders, to partner with the council on programmes capable of improving the welfare of residents and advancing the development of Isoko North.

Earlier, the NBA Oleh Branch delegation commended Ogorugba for what it described as his exemplary leadership and commitment to the development of the local government.

The delegation also praised the chairman for supporting the implementation of President Bola Ahmed Tinubu’s Renewed Hope Agenda and Governor Sheriff Oborevwori’s MORE Agenda in Isoko North.

The lawyers noted that several visible projects had been executed across the local government since Ogorugba assumed office, saying the projects had positively impacted residents.

The NBA executives expressed their readiness to collaborate with the council on areas of mutual interest, particularly legal awareness, advocacy and initiatives aimed at strengthening peace and justice in the local government.

The visit provided an opportunity for both sides to explore areas of collaboration and underscore the importance of professional engagement in promoting good governance, justice and community development.
